Senior Technical Writer – DS SolidWorks
JOB TITLE: Senior Technical Writer – DS SolidWorks
LOCATION: Boston Campus ~ Waltham, MA
COMPANY INTRODUCTION: Dassault Systèmes, the 3D Experience Company, provides business and people with virtual universes to imagine sustainable innovations. Its world-leading solutions transform the way products are designed, produced, and supported. Dassault Systèmes’ collaborative solutions foster social innovation, expanding possibilities for the virtual world to improve the real world. The group brings value to over 150,000 customers of all sizes, in all industries, in more than 80 countries. For more information, visit www.3ds.com.
CATIA, SolidWorks, ENOVIA, SIMULIA, DELMIA, 3D VIA, 3DSwYm, EXALEAD and Netvibes are registered trademarks of Dassault Systèmes or its subsidiaries in the US and/or other countries.
Position Description: Document a Product Data Management (PDM) connector between the SolidWorks CAD design product and the ENOVIA database. The product documentation includes installation, administration, and end-user online help. Gain technical expertise by discovering and dealing with installation prerequisites, by installing, configuring, and using the software independently, and by meeting with key contributors. Meet tight deadlines. Duties include: researching, writing, authoring online help, working with other cross-brand groups in the company to adhere to quality standards for all documentation, supporting language translation.
Education: B.S. /B.A. or higher (preferably in engineering, math or science, or computer-related field); Software Technical Writing degree or certification.
Requirements:
• A minimum of 5-8 years writing documentation for system administrators, engineers, and a technically-sophisticated audience of design engineers who use the product. Experience in a highly-technical environment, preferably a Product Data Management (PDM) or Product Lifecycle Management (PLM) company, is preferred.
• The candidate must have excellent written and verbal communication skills. A desire to work in a collaborative, cross-brand, multicultural environment is essential, as are superior organizational and time management skills.
• Experience with XML DITA is required. Experience with the XMetaL application is strongly preferred.
• The ideal candidate possesses a high degree of flexibility and independence, with the ability to persevere through challenging environments across multiple teams.
• Familiarity with server and database installation and configuration is a plus.
